About the Job:
- We are seeking a dynamic and highly capable CSR professional with 5-10 years of experience in managing, implementing and scaling Corporate Social Responsibility initiatives. The role demands exceptional speed of execution, strong process orientation, quick and accurate documentation skills, and the ability to work across new technological tools, and stakeholders. This is a high-ownership role suited for someone who works efficiently in fast-paced scenarios, demonstrates exceptional clarity in communication and consistently brings strong analytical judgment to deliver quality outputs.
- This role requires a balanced combination of Program governance, strong documentation discipline, field engagement, and the ability to translate data into actionable insights for leadership.
Roles and Responsibilities:
- Strategy & Planning:
- Developing and implementing comprehensive CSR strategies that align with the company’s approved CSR policy and thematic areas.
- Support budgeting, documentation, and creation of presentations for senior management and CSR Committee.
- Identify opportunities for innovation, scalability, and technology adoption within CSR programs.
- Governance, Compliance & Process Excellence:
- Develop and update SOPs, policies, partner guidelines, and internal workflows for CSR governance.
- Ensure full statutory compliance under the Companies Act CSR provisions and CSR amendments.
- Implement strong internal controls around data accuracy, approval processes, fund flow, and partner reporting.
- Documentation:
- Maintain a centralized repository of all essential documents for audit readiness.
- Develop templates for standard CSR documentation, reports, and partner submissions.
- Ensure proper documentation of field visit notes, partner communications, and approvals.
- Reporting:
- Consolidate and present data for impact stories, annual report, presentations, management meetings, and BRSR reporting.
- Liaise with Compliance team for statutory CSR reporting and board-level documentation.
- Prepare project fact sheets, case studies, and evidence-based impact narratives for Annual reporting.
- Proposals Review and Agreement Signing:
- Conduct due diligence on NGOs / Implementation Partners for project suitability, credibility, and compliance.
- Review CSR proposals and engage with NGOs/partners for refining program design and outcomes.
- Draft, review, and coordinate with Legal team for agreement finalization and signing.
- Monitoring & Evaluation:
- Create monthly/quarterly reporting templates in alignment with approved activities and KPIs.
- Review and document monthly/quarterly progress reports submitted by partners.
- Conduct field visits to project sites for monitoring, validation, and evaluation of on-ground activities.
- Review and process grant requests, including validation of UCs, expense breakups, spending plans, and budget adherence.
- Monitor projects effectively and document deviations, risks, and mitigation actions.
- Regularly review financial and compliance reports and provide corrective feedback to partners.
- Coordinate internal audits and support the commissioning and execution of third-party impact assessment studies.
- Others:
- Knowledge of new technical tools and software for data capture, monitoring, reporting, and analytics.
- Ability to manage multi-state or pan-India CSR programs with diverse partners and stakeholder ecosystems.
- Represent the company at CSR-related events, conferences, and forums to enhance visibility and partnerships.
- Draft award applications, project nominations, and recognition submissions.
- Stay updated with CSR trends, sector best practices, and regulatory changes.
Required Education Qualification: Master’s Degree in Engineering / MBA / MA in CSR / Communications / Master’s Degree in Ecology/ Biodiversity Conservation/ Wildlife Sciences/ Environmental Sciences/ Forestry, MSc Agriculture, MTech in Hydrology or related field
Experience Required: 5–10 years in CSR industry, with varied experience.
Skills required:
- Strong process orientation with the ability to create and manage SOPs, templates, and governance mechanisms.
- Outstanding written and verbal communication, with clarity, conciseness, and command over formal documentation.
- Exceptional speed and precision in execution, ensuring timely review, documentation, reporting, and follow-ups.
- Advanced analytical skills, including the ability to interpret program data, budgets, and field insights.
- Proficiency in MS Office (Excel, PowerPoint, Word) and project management tools.
- Strong multi-project management capability, especially in fast-paced, high-volume CSR environments.
- High ownership mindset, with the ability to work independently and take responsibility for outcomes end‑to‑end.
- Continuous learner, staying updated on evolving CSR trends, development-sector innovations, and regulatory changes.
- Strong understanding of CSR law & compliance, including Section 135 of the Companies Act, CSR Amendments, Schedule VII, and statutory reporting requirements.
